Townhall’s MKH, as well as other media outlets, report on an event that occurred during a Hillary rally today. Two college-age men held up signs reading “Iron My Shirt”.

Two protestors just stood up in the audience holding orange signs that read “IRON MY SHIRT,” and chanted “Iron my shirt, Iron my shirt” for a few seconds until led out by security.

She said, “Obviously the remnants of sexism are alive and well.”

The crowd stood and cheered loudly to drown out the protestors. A few minutes later, she went back to the well with uncharacteristic humor:

“We talk about a lot of issues, and we’ll talk about more tonight. If anyone out there would like me to explain to them how to iron their own shirt, I can do that.”

She got a good laugh, and went on to talk about breaking the glass ceiling, to another standing “O”.
